#sidebar{display:none}@media (min-width:981px){#left-area{width:100%;padding:23px 0px 0px!important;float:none!important}}#contatti label,.et_pb_contact_right p{color:#fff!important}span.et_pb_contact_field_options_title{display:none}.em-booking-form-details .em-booking-submit{background-color:#44627C;color:#fff;padding:15px 20px 15px 20px;border:none;border-radius:50px;font-family:'Lato',Helvetica,Arial,Lucida,sans-serif;font-weight:700;text-transform:uppercase}li .fab{font-size:20px;margin-right:-30px}.ui-widget-header{border:1px solid #33515f;background:#3D6071;color:#fff!important}.ui-state-highlight,.ui-widget-content .ui-state-highlight{border:1px solid #A6D143;background:#d4e5ad;color:#363636}.entry-content table{border:none}.ui-state-active{color:#A6D143!important;border:1px solid #A6D143!important}.ui-state-default{color:#3D6071}#mailpoet_form_1 .mailpoet_text,#mailpoet_form_1 .mailpoet_textarea{width:90%!important;padding:15px;border-radius:100px}#mailpoet_form_1 .mailpoet_checkbox_label{font-weight:400!important;color:white}#mailpoet_form_1 .mailpoet_paragraph{line-height:20px;color:white}.mailpoet_paragraph p{padding-bottom:0.2em}input.mailpoet_submit{-webkit-appearance:none;padding:15px;background-color:#44627C;color:#fff;text-transform:uppercase;border:none;border-radius:100px;width:200px;font-weight:bold}.mc4wp-form input[type=text],input[type=email],input[type=textarea],select[name="MMERGE5"]{width:100%;padding:14px 14px!important;background-color:#fff;font-size:16px;font-weight:400;-webkit-appearance:none}.mc4wp-form input[type=submit]{width:100%;letter-spacing:5px;padding:6px 12px;font-size:17px;background:#A2C94A;border:none;border-radius:50px;color:#fff;font-size:17px;font-family:'Montserrat',Helvetica,Arial,Lucida,sans-serif}.tnp-field label{color:#fff}.yikes-easy-mc-form .yikes-easy-mc-submit-button{letter-spacing:5px;font-size:17px;background:#A2C94A;border:none;border-radius:50px}.yikes-easy-mc-form input[type=email],.yikes-easy-mc-form input[type=number],.yikes-easy-mc-form input[type=password],.yikes-easy-mc-form input[type=text],.yikes-easy-mc-form input[type=url],.yikes-easy-mc-form select,.yikes-easy-mc-form textarea{width:100%;padding:14px 4%!important;border-width:0;border-radius:3px;color:#666;background-color:#fff;font-size:16px;font-weight:400;-webkit-appearance:none}.field-no-label{color:#fff;font-size:12px}.yikes-easy-mc-form .yikes-easy-mc-submit-button{color:#fff;font-size:17px;font-family:'Montserrat',Helvetica,Arial,Lucida,sans-serif}input#quiz-form{max-width:40px;margin-left:10px}.wpcf7-submit{background:#a6d143;padding:15px 30px;color:#fff;font-size:22px;font-family:'Poppins';font-weight:bold;border:none;transition:1s;width:100%;border-radius:100px}.wpcf7-submit:hover{background:#83a32c}.frm{background:#fff!important;padding:18px!important;width:100%;font-size:16px;border:none!important}.wpcf7 form.sent .wpcf7-response-output{color:#39c36e}@media all and (max-width:1360px){#et_mobile_nav_menu{display:block!important}#top-menu{display:none!important}}.mec-wrap :not(.elementor-widget-container)>p{font-size:17px}.mec-single-event-description.mec-events-content ol li,.mec-single-event-description.mec-events-content ul li{font-size:17px}